Challenging Cases in Spine Surgery


ABDULHAK / MARZOUK  

Challenging Cases in Spine Surgery

280 Seiten, 1. Auflage, 2005
190 Abbildungen

This book presents complex traumatic, inflammatory, neoplastic, infectous, degenerative, and congenital spine surgery cases. With the latest treatments for 87 spine cases presented in a streamlined case example format, it is an ideal text for every day use in the professionel setting.

In each chapter the author´s outline of pathological findings and treatment options helps you quickly master the thought process and reasoning that accompanies each stage of spinal procedures.

With the aid of more than 180 illustrations, you will learn how to interpret initial presentation and classic radiology findings to make informed decisions about operative versus conservative treatments. The book also discusses the latest technologies pertaining to bone morphogenetic protein and percutanous spine surgery to help the clinician remain at the forefront of the spine field.
